  • Munich Conference

    The Munich Agreement was a settlement permitting Nazi Germany's annexation of portions of Czechoslovakia. This land was regarded as the Sudetenland. The purpose of the conference was to discuss the future of the Sudetenland in the face of ethnic demands made by Adolf Hitler. The agreement was signed by Germany, France, the United Kingdom, and Italy.
  • Non-Agression Pact

    On this day the Germany and the Soviet Union signed an agreement not to attack each other. Adolf Hitler used the pact to make sure Germany was able to invade Poland. The pact fell apart when Germany invaded the Soviet Union later.

  • Lend Lease Act passed

    This was a program inhich the United States supplied France, Great Britain, the Republic of China, and later the USSR and other Allied nations with food, oil, and materiel. The United States shipped a total of 50 billion dollars worth of material. The terms of the agreement provided that the materiel was to be used until time for their return or destruction. In practice very little equipment was returned.
  • Period: to

    Operation Barbarossa

    This was the code name for the Nazi invation of the Soviet Union. The operation was driven by Adolf Hitler's desire to conquer the Soviet territories as outlined in Mein Kampf. This resulted in the opening of the Eastern Front.

  • Bataan Death March

    On this day American and Philipino prisoners of war were forced to march from Saisaih Pt. and Mariveles to Camp O'Donnell. 2,500-10,000 Philipino and 100-650 American Prisoners of war died making this journey. This 60 mile march is described as servere physical abuse and resulted in many deaths.

  • Period: to

    Battle of the Bulge

    The Battle of the Bulge was the last major Nazi offensive against the Allies in World War Two. The battle was the last attempt by Hitler to split the Allies in two in their drive towards Germany and destroy their ability to supply themselves.
  • Period: to

    Battle of Iwo JIma

    In this battle the United States captured the island of Iwo Jima from the Japanese.This five-week battle brought about some of the fiercest and bloodiest fighting of the War in the Pacific of World War II.
